I am using Elan's version of troff, Eroff, and would like to
print on legal size (or bigger paper). The original question was
about selecting manual feed and legal size paper on a postscript
laser, in particular a LaserWriter. Well the output of eps is pretty
close and contains the necessary procedure.
.
.
.
/mf { statusdict /manualfeed true put } bind def
/af { statusdict /manualfeed false put } bind def
af
Just change the af to mf and add legal to the mf procedure
/mf { statusdict legal /manualfeed true put } bind def
and things work except the text is magnified and hence only a
small part of the page appears on the output.
I was wondering what postscript commands might be responsible for
this so I might track down the necessary changes. I have the
postscript reference manual and should have the cookbook this
weekend but a pointer in the right direction would be a big help.
